E-mail as a Communication Tool in Education
E-mail remains one of the most foundational internet services, facilitating direct and asynchronous communication between educators and students. It is widely used for disseminating course updates, sharing resources, and providing feedback on assignments. According to Godwin-Jones (2008), e-mail fosters a structured communication channel that allows students to seek clarification and engage with instructors beyond classroom hours. For instance, a student might e-mail a lecturer to discuss a project deadline or request additional reading materials, ensuring continuity in learning. However, limitations exist, such as the potential for delayed responses and the risk of miscommunication due to the lack of non-verbal cues. Despite these drawbacks, e-mail’s reliability and formality make it indispensable in maintaining academic correspondence.
Online Learning Platforms for Structured Education
Online learning platforms, such as Moodle and Blackboard, are integral internet services that provide structured environments for course delivery. These platforms host learning materials, discussion forums, and assessment tools, creating a virtual classroom accessible to students anytime. Bates (2015) highlights that such platforms enable blended learning by combining traditional teaching with digital resources, catering to diverse learning styles. For example, a student might access recorded lectures or complete quizzes at their own pace, enhancing flexibility. Yet, challenges include the digital divide, as not all students have reliable internet access, potentially exacerbating educational inequalities. Nevertheless, these platforms are vital for scaling education and supporting remote learning, particularly in the wake of global disruptions like the COVID-19 pandemic.
Video Conferencing for Real-Time Interaction
Video conferencing tools, such as Zoom and Microsoft Teams, have become essential internet services for real-time interaction in education. These platforms facilitate live lectures, group discussions, and virtual tutorials, bridging geographical barriers. According to Garrison and Vaughan (2008), video conferencing supports a sense of community among learners, replicating face-to-face engagement in online settings. A practical example is a university seminar conducted via Zoom, where students from different locations collaborate on a group project. However, technical issues like poor internet connectivity and the phenomenon of ‘Zoom fatigue’ can hinder effectiveness. Despite these issues, video conferencing remains a powerful tool for synchronous learning, ensuring immediacy and interactivity in educational delivery.
Social Media as a Collaborative Learning Space
Social media platforms, including Twitter and Facebook, have emerged as unconventional yet impactful internet services in education. They enable informal learning through knowledge sharing, peer interaction, and community building. Tess (2013) notes that social media can enhance student engagement by providing spaces for discussion and resource exchange outside formal academic channels. For instance, a course-specific Facebook group might allow students to share study tips or debate key concepts, fostering collaborative learning. Nevertheless, distractions and the risk of misinformation are significant concerns, requiring careful moderation. While not without flaws, social media’s ability to connect learners informally makes it a valuable supplementary tool in the teaching and learning process.
Cloud Storage for Resource Accessibility
Cloud storage services, such as Google Drive and Dropbox, offer secure, accessible storage solutions that support teaching and learning by enabling the sharing and management of educational resources. These services allow students and educators to store, access, and collaborate on documents from any location with internet connectivity. As Garrison (2011) argues, cloud storage promotes collaborative learning by facilitating group projects and real-time editing of shared materials. For example, students working on a joint presentation can simultaneously edit a document on Google Drive, streamlining workflow. However, concerns around data privacy and potential loss due to technical failures must be addressed. Overall, cloud storage enhances efficiency and accessibility, proving invaluable in modern educational contexts.
Critical Analysis of Internet Services in Education
While the aforementioned internet services offer substantial benefits, their integration into teaching and learning is not without challenges. A key issue is the digital divide, which limits access for students from disadvantaged backgrounds, as highlighted by Bates (2015). Additionally, over-reliance on technology may reduce critical thinking if students passively consume content rather than actively engage with it. Furthermore, cybersecurity risks, such as data breaches on cloud platforms or phishing via e-mail, pose threats to the safe use of these services. Therefore, educators must balance the adoption of internet services with strategies to mitigate these risks, ensuring inclusive and secure learning environments.
